Output e99ee89fe0956d8d6525f350c1bf26a8342e09ddb0fd0c4088c6035ba338c7a2:45

value
17068804
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c56eea6bb1a7db1092b2356df6525dc92057ae1 OP_EQUAL
address
MDQCv6bm6nHAvQi6rfMjg7GfAHFkEpa97q
transaction
e99ee89fe0956d8d6525f350c1bf26a8342e09ddb0fd0c4088c6035ba338c7a2
spent
true